Transaction 8dc6c821634a39095199615aff7cfd7f152e0e3820af38216053f6e30735d953

1 Input
1 Outputs
  • 8dc6c821634a39095199615aff7cfd7f152e0e3820af38216053f6e30735d953:0
  • value  25895
    address  3DPaxb3MZ1ETLBQ7fmqdJ1QL3AhxXiEEuo